Ovechkin scores twice, red-hot Capitals shut out Devils 4-0
With Ovechkin rolling, the Capitals have won nine of their past 10 games and are back atop the East Division. They're tied at 48 points with former coach Barry Trotz's New York Islanders but hold the tiebreaker having played one fewer game. Washington looked more like itself — a poised, veteran team — in the second game against New Jersey in two nights following four days off.
